theantichick 2,204 Posted December 7, 2016 My surgeon cleared me for the pool at 4 weeks. If you are going to need to get in the Water before then, talk with your doc and ask if it would be OK if you had waterproof bandages on the incisions. I used them for showering until my incisions were closed, and they work pretty well. The incisions are small enough I got mine at the local drugstore and didn't need any special order bandages. perspectiveiseverything 105 Posted December 8, 2016 Ask your doctor. I swim a lot and my doctor told me 3 weeks (he said up to 4 depending on how the incisions were healing, but gave me the all-clear at three weeks because they were looking great).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
